New Jersey Civic Information Consortium (NJCIC) — a publicly funded nonprofit — has invested $12 million in independent local news by and for New Jersey residents. One in four households receives its news from NJCIC-backed outlets, but Gov. Mikie Sherrill’s proposed FY27 budget would ZERO OUT funding for this important initiative. As newsrooms across the state have shut down and journalists have lost their jobs, too many communities have been left in the dark. The NJCIC has funded all kinds of projects to give people the news and information they need — and this is especially crucial given how the Trump administration and its billionaire allies are pushing propaganda in place of honest journalism. Please invest in local news by supporting Senate BR #453. A well-funded NJCIC helps us stay informed and engaged.
